Macquarie Cosmetic Medicine is pleased to offer Fraxel
Laser Treatment. The breakthrough Fraxel Laser Treatment
was developed by Reliant Technologies in conjunction with
the Wellman Center for Photomedicine at Massachusetts General
Hospital, the developers of the novel concept of "fractional"
laser therapy. Fraxel Laser Treatment can be used to improve
conditions present in superficial and deeper layers of the
skin. FDA-cleared indications include: skin resurfacing;
treatment of wrinkles around the eyes; and treatment of
pigmented lesions, such as age spots, sun spots, and melasma.
FDA clearance is pending for treatment of scars resulting
from acne, surgery, or trauma. After Fraxel Laser Treatment,
skin generally feels softer, looks smoother and tighter,
and pores are usually smaller.
To appreciate the benefits of Fraxel Laser Treatment, think
of a family portrait or digital photograph in need of high-quality
restoration or touch-up. Just as a damaged painting is delicately
restored one area at a time, or a photographic image is
altered, pixel by pixel, the Fraxel laser improves your
appearance by affecting only a fraction of your skin at
a time with thousands of microscopic laser spots. It's like
digital photo-editing software for your skin!

Fraxel Laser Treatment can be performed in our office using
topical anesthesia. Treatment takes about 30 minutes, depending
on the size of the area(s) being treated. Because the procedure
does not "ablate" or remove the outer skin layer,
patients can resume routine activities right after treatment.
Swelling is minimal and generally resolves in about 2 days.
The skin will have a pinkish tone for 5 to 7 days.
For optimal improvement, a series of 3 to 5 treatments spaced
2 to 4 weeks apart has been shown to be most effective.
Results are both immediate and progressive, with noticeable,
beneficial effects accumulating over 1 to 3 months.
